Understanding Local Legal Services: Benefits for Businesses
Local legal services play a pivotal role in fostering robust business growth and development within communities. When businesses partner with local support attorneys, they gain a deep understanding of the region’s unique legal landscape. This knowledge is invaluable when navigating complex regulations, zoning laws, and industry-specific requirements that vary from one locality to another. By leveraging local expertise, companies can ensure compliance, mitigate risks, and avoid costly legal pitfalls.
Moreover, engaging with local attorneys fosters a sense of community and builds strong relationships. These connections are beneficial for long-term success as they can lead to better access to resources, opportunities for collaboration, and a more supportive business environment. Local legal services not only provide practical solutions to current challenges but also empower businesses to thrive sustainably within their specific geographical contexts.
The Role of Support Attorneys in Community Development
Support attorneys play a pivotal role in community development by offering specialized legal services tailored to the unique needs of their regions. They act as a cornerstone, connecting vulnerable populations with justice and opportunities. These attorneys often work within non-profit organizations or community-based initiatives, providing pro bono or low-cost legal assistance to those who may otherwise face significant barriers to accessing the judiciary.
By focusing on local legal services, support attorneys foster economic growth, promote social equity, and strengthen the fabric of their communities. They navigate complex laws and regulations, ensuring that individuals—especially marginalized groups—understand their rights and can access essential services. Through their efforts, these lawyers contribute to a more just and inclusive society, where legal aid is accessible and empowers positive change at the grassroots level.
How Local Experts Enhance Access to Justice
Having access to justice is a fundamental right, and local support attorneys play a pivotal role in making this right accessible to all members of the community. These experts are deeply rooted in their communities, which gives them an unparalleled understanding of the legal landscape specific to that area. They navigate the intricate web of local laws, regulations, and judicial practices, ensuring that individuals can access the resources and representation they need without facing overwhelming barriers.
Local legal services provide a critical safety net for those who might otherwise be left behind. By offering their expertise and insights, these attorneys bridge the gap between complex legal systems and everyday people. They demystify the process, guide clients through each step, and advocate for their rights, thereby fostering a fair and just society where everyone has an equal chance to seek and obtain justice.
